Block Foundation Installation in Boston, MA
Block foundation installation services involve constructing a sturdy base using concrete blocks to support various structures on a property. This type of foundation is commonly used for building retaining walls, basement walls, or additional support for decks and extensions. Property owners typically seek this service when they need a durable, cost-effective foundation solution that can withstand the local soil conditions and provide stability for future construction projects.
Before requesting block foundation install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ation, the type of blocks used, and the overall structural design. It’s also important to consider factors such as drainage, soil stability, and any necessary permits or inspections. Clear communication about these details can help ensure the foundation is built to meet the specific needs of the property and its intended use.

Block Foundation Installation Questions
What types of projects require block foundation installation? Block foundations are commonly used for basement walls, retaining walls, and supporting structures for additions or new buildings.
How do block foundations benefit property owners? They provide durable support, help prevent moisture intrusion, and can be customized to fit various structural needs.
What should homeowners consider before installing a block foundation? It's important to evaluate soil conditions, drainage, and the structural requirements of the project.
Is block foundation installation suitable for all types of properties? It is suitable for many residential and commercial projects, especially where a strong, stable foundation is needed.
